            Abstract : 
This document research on vehicle stability control methods using yaw rate and the mass center sideslip angle aim at electromechanical brake system . Following the linear 2 DoF vehicle handling performance model as control target, a control system model was built based on the dynamic relationship between the vehicle yaw moment and the vehicle state deviations. An chassis control approach about yaw moment decision and divide methods was proposed. The simulation results showed that the controller could improve the vehicle handling and stability performance effectively.
